The Tigers are currently dealing with a critical situation regarding Jack Flaherty. As of May 31, 2026, his $20 million contract has raised concerns about the team's financial flexibility. The issue comes at a pivotal moment for the Tigers as they aim to improve their roster. Determining how to address Flaherty's contract could influence their strategies moving forward.
